Did you know young people with a mentor are:
• 55% more likely to enroll in college
• 46% less likely to use illegal drugs
• They show higher confidence, stronger relationships, and better academic outcomes
• Nearly half of the youth served by Big Brothers Big Sisters nationwide identify as Black, showing how critical mentoring is for creating opportunity and equity
